Two Worcester cups and saucers, c.1770, well painted with arrangements of fruit and scattered insects, reserved on an apple green ground, blue crossed swords mark and 9 mark to one, and a plate painted with exotic birds, the latter probably later decorated, 21.3cm max. (5)
Provenance: the Clifford Henderson Collection.
